What is a World Café? A world café is a good, simple process for bringing people together around questions that matter. We believe that people can work together no matter who they are, where they are from and what they know – we are all equal and we are all valuable, and by talking together we can use our collective wisdom to shape the future another way. Edinburgh is Scotland’s most diverse city and many people with experience of migration wonder how to enjoy and celebrate their own culture, in their own way. They wonder how to belong to two places at the same time. They wonder how to meet and interact with people from other cultures and overcome the stereotypes and assumptions that often create barriers. Why is this world café important? According to the global organisation United Cities and Local Government group, by 2050 one third of the world’s population will live in cities. Migration has always been a reality and with economic globalisation and climate change, it will only increase.
